When my kids were just little Mouseketeers, I liked bringing my own double stroller from home. I liked having it in the airport, at my resort, and when traveling to the buses or around Downtown Disney.
There are strollers for rent at the parks. Click
HERE for information and pricing. These might not be great for your 9 month old, as they are the hard plastic type that do not recline. I think you might be better off bringing your own cozy stroller from home that your kids are secure in and familiar with. The only downfall is that strollers need to be folded before boarding buses, but you will be an expert at that in no time!
Quick tip: when entering the parks, check for the Baby Care Centers which are great for feedings and changings. You will love these centers, I spent plenty of time there when my kids were in diapers!
